Fresh Food, Great Beer and Excellent Service We had a brilliant experience at BrewDog Las Vegas and honestly I’m surprised it isn’t rated higher. The food was excellent. My burger was fresh, juicy and full of flavour, and my girlfriend’s club sandwich - served in a burger bun - was gorgeous and clearly made with quality ingredients. Everything tasted fresh and well put together. We were lucky to visit at lunchtime during happy hour, so the beers were half price, which made it even better value. They had a couple of locally brewed Vegas options on tap - I went for Neonize, which was fruity, refreshing and really enjoyable. Service was spot on too. Chris in particular stood out - friendly, attentive and genuinely welcoming. Overall, we were really impressed. Great food, great beer and great service. Definitely worth supporting BrewDog in Las Vegas.
This was a fun experience. Get ready to hike up some stairs but the top floor is a great vibe. We had a great server. The nachos were great and the extra beer cheese was a great suggestion by our server. My buddy got wings and I got the big rib burger. I’m a burger aficionado and save 5 stars for truly standout best burgers and this one was very good but I thought the short rib was a little dry but overall a pretty dang good burger. I would definitely go back and try out some more things on the menu. The margaritas were great too.
Stopped in because they said they had a rooftop bar and we were pleasantly surprised. 56 beers on tap and buy one get one free appetizers. We had the soft pretzel and the nachos, and both were good and both were huge. I don’t think 1 person could eat any one appetizer by themselves. View of the strip is a bit off center, but relatively unblocked. Stop in for a bite!
